In today's fast-paced logistics environment, optimizing space utilization in warehouses is crucial for efficiency. A well-planned layout can boost accessibility and reduce costs. According to research by the Warehousing Education and Research Council (WERC), effective space management can lead to as much as a 30% increase in storage capacity.
One effective strategy is to implement vertical storage solutions. Utilizing higher shelves can reclaim valuable floor space. For example, automated storage and retrieval systems (AS/RS) have been shown to improve space usage significantly. They reduce human error while maximizing storage density. However, it's essential to assess weight limits carefully. Overloading shelves can lead to safety issues and potential damage.
Another consideration is the flow of materials through the warehouse. Designing aisles wide enough for easy navigation can minimize bottlenecks. Moreover, a common mistake is neglecting to analyze SKU characteristics. Grouping fast-moving items near loading docks can speed up order fulfillment. Understanding a product's lifecycle helps in better space allocation. Regular audits and adjustments are vital to adapt to changing inventory needs.
Effective inventory management is crucial for warehouse efficiency. A report by the Institute of Supply Chain Management highlights that poor inventory control can increase operational costs by up to 20%. Implementing systematic practices can significantly alleviate this issue. For instance, utilizing the ABC analysis method allows organizations to prioritize inventory based on value and turnover rates. This method can enhance stock visibility and ensure critical items are always available.
Technology plays a vital role in modern inventory management. Automating inventory tracking reduces human error and enhances data accuracy. According to a study by McKinsey & Company, businesses that adopt such systems see a 30% reduction in inventory holding costs. However, technology requires training and adjustment time, which some organizations struggle with. Acknowledging this period of adaption is essential for long-term success.
Moreover, regular audits and cycle counts are necessary despite their time-consuming nature. They ensure that physical inventory matches recorded inventory, which is often not the case. One report indicates that over 25% of companies experience discrepancies in their inventory records. Taking time to address these gaps can lead to more reliable data and improved decision-making in inventory management. Adapting to these practices may require changes in culture and approach, presenting both challenges and opportunities for improvement.
